Describe how the borrowed cash at a local bank affects the three elements of the accounting equation.
A borrowed cash at a local bank will increase the assets and liabilities while leave the equity unaffected.
The proforma journal entry for this transaction is as follows:
Account | Debit | Credit |
---|---|---|
Cash | XXX | |
Loan payable | XXX |
Cash is an asset account and a debit to it increases it. On the other hand, loan payable is a liability which increases when credited.
